Villy-P/README.md

Hello!

I am a student at UT Austin building tools for the open-source ecosystem. My work focuses on systems-level architecture, computer graphics, and reactive web frameworks using TypeScript, C++, and Svelte.

Currently, I'm working on a component library for all my web projects, a custom made compiler for a programming language I'm designing, and tinkering with Unreal Engine to make nature scenes.

When I'm not working on my projects, I'm usually exploring new web frameworks or writing blog articles related to cool tech stuff I find.
